How to test the performance and accuracy of current transformers?
  The performance and accuracy of current transformers are important characteristics, and they are usually tested in the following aspects:
Appearance inspection:
First, observe whether the current transformer has obvious signs of cracking, deformation, burning, etc., and whether there is a smell of burnt insulation. These signs may indicate that the transformer is damaged.
Insulation resistance test:
Use the resistance range of the multimeter to measure the insulation resistance of the current transformer. Connect the red test lead of the multimeter to the primary side of the current transformer and the black test lead to the secondary side. If the insulation resistance value is lower than the specified value, it means that the insulation performance of the current transformer has deteriorated and needs to be repaired or replaced.
Ratio test:
The ratio test is an important method to judge the quality of the current transformer. First, switch the multimeter to the current range and measure the current on the primary side. Then, switch the multimeter to the voltage range and measure the voltage on the secondary side. According to the ratio formula: ratio = primary current / secondary current, calculate the actual ratio of the current transformer. If the actual ratio is significantly different from the nominal ratio, it means that there is a problem with the current transformer.
Accuracy test:
Accuracy test is a method to evaluate the measurement accuracy of current transformers. First, connect a current source with a known current value to the primary side of the current transformer. Then, measure the current value on the secondary side. According to the accuracy formula: Accuracy = (measured value - true value) / true value × 100%, calculate the accuracy of the current transformer. If the accuracy exceeds the specified range, it means that the measurement accuracy of the current transformer does not meet the standard.
Load test:
Load test is to evaluate the performance of the current transformer under different load conditions. First, connect current sources with different load values ​​to the primary side of the current transformer in turn. Then, measure the current value on the secondary side and record the data. By comparing the measured values ​​under different load conditions with the theoretical values, the load characteristics of the current transformer are evaluated.
Calibration and measurement errors:
Use standard current sources and high-precision measuring equipment to calibrate the current transformer and measure its basic errors, including the error at rated current, the error at rated voltage, the load error, and the temperature error.
Short-circuit impedance and phase angle error:
Measure the short-circuit impedance and phase angle error of the current transformer, which are critical to ensure the stability and safety of the current transformer in actual use.
Dynamic stability and thermal stability verification:
According to the rated current and time parameters of the current transformer, dynamic stability and thermal stability verification are performed to ensure its performance under specific fault conditions.
  Through the above tests, the performance and accuracy of the current transformer can be fully evaluated to ensure its safe and accurate operation in the power system.
